系统发展生命周期,也称软件生命周期,是系统工程、信息系统和软件工程中的术语,用于描述一个信息系统从规划、创建、测试到最终完成部署的全过程。系统开发生命周期的概念对于硬件和软件系统都是适用的,这些系统可能只由硬件或软件组成,也可能两者都有。
软件开发是根据用户要求建造出软件系统或者系统中软件部分的一个产品开发的过程。软件开发是一项包括需求获取、开发规划、需求分析和设计、编程实现、软件测试、版本控制的系统工程。换句话说,软件开发就是一系列最终构建出软件产品的活动。软件开发可能包括研究、新的开发工作、修改、复用、重新设计、维护,或者任何最终获得软件产品的其他活动。尤其是在软件开发过程的初始阶段,其中可能会涉及许多的部门,包括市场营销、工程设计、研究与开发以及一般意义上的管理。
配置管理也称为组态管理,是系统工程的一部分,应用在专案的完整生命周期中,使产品的性能、功能以及实体属性和其需求、设计、操作资讯可以保持一致。 配置管理已普遍使用在军事工程组织中,在复杂系统的系统发展生命周期中管理其变更。在军事以外的应用中,配置管理也用在IT服务管理中,像是信息技术基础架构库、土木工程的领域模型,或是其他像是道路、桥梁、运河、水坝及建筑物的专案中。
自动化技术是一门综合性技术,它和控制论、信息论、系统工程、电子计算机技术、电子学、液压及气压技术、自动控制等都有着十分密切的关系,而其中又以“控制理论”和“计算机技术”对自动化技术的影响最大。一些过程已经被完全自动化。广义来说,通常是指不需借助人力亲自操作机器或机构,而能利用动物以外的其他装置元件或能源,来达成人类所期盼执行的工作。更狭义地说即是以生化、机电、电脑、通讯、水力、蒸汽等科学知识与应用工具,进行设计来代替人力或减轻人力或简化人类工作程序的机构机制,皆可称之。
需求可追踪性也称为需求可追溯性,是需求管理中的一部分,和软件开发及系统工程有关。IEEE Systems and Software Engineering Vocabulary有定义通用的可追踪性矩阵,定义如下
中国系统工程学会,是由中华人民共和国从事系统科学和系统工程的科技工作者组成的学术组织,隶属于中国科学技术协会。成立于1980年11月18日,住所为北京市中关村东路55号思源楼。
需求工程是指在工程设计过程中定义、记录和维护需求的过程。 这在系统工程和软件工程中是一个共同的角色。
在系统工程及需求工程中,非功能性需求是指依一些条件判断系统运作情形或其特性,而不是针对系统特定行为的需求分析。和非功能性需求相对的是功能需求,后者会定义系统特定的行为或功能。非功能性需求也可以视为为了满足客户业务需求而需要符合,但又不在功能性需求以内的特性。
自动化技术是一门综合性技术,它和控制论、信息论、系统工程、电子计算机技术、电子学、液压及气压技术、自动控制等都有着十分密切的关系,而其中又以“控制理论”和“计算机技术”对自动化技术的影响最大。一些过程已经被完全自动化。广义来说,通常是指不需借助人力亲自操作机器或机构,而能利用动物以外的其他装置元件或能源,来达成人类所期盼执行的工作。更狭义地说即是以生化、机电、电脑、通讯、水力、蒸汽等科学知识与应用工具,进行设计来代替人力或减轻人力或简化人类工作程序的机构机制,皆可称之。
配置管理也称为组态管理,是系统工程的一部分,应用在专案的完整生命周期中,使产品的性能、功能以及实体属性和其需求、设计、操作资讯可以保持一致。 配置管理已普遍使用在军事工程组织中,在复杂系统的系统发展生命周期中管理其变更。在军事以外的应用中,配置管理也用在IT服务管理中,像是信息技术基础架构库、土木工程的领域模型,或是其他像是道路、桥梁、运河、水坝及建筑物的专案中。